How an Inmate Makes a Phone Call to You or Others from Meeker County Jail & Detention The Meeker County Jail & Detention reserves the right to deny any person the right to enter the jail it chooses and for any reason. If you and the inmate are under a court order to have no contact with each other, your visit will be denied. If you are a co-defendant with the inmate in a pending case, your visit will be denied. It is likely that the Meeker County Jail & Detention will deny visitation to anyone with a past felony conviction regardless of probation/parole status.Ĭall 32prior to arriving for the specific jail guideline regarding your legal status. Jails limit the number of people that can visit an inmate to two adults each visit.Ĭhildren under age 18 must be accompanied by the parent or legal guardian.Ĭall 32 to ask specific questions about this policy or click here for any updates to this policy. Those with warrants are denied visitation or if allowed to visit, will be arrested at the jail. Visitation applicants in Meeker County must sometimes submit to a background check. Who Can Visit an Inmate in Meeker County Jail & DetentionĪnyone over the age of 18, who isn't on felony probation and can produce a valid government-issued photo ID can be approved to visit an inmate in this jail.
